Icycle

posted by Wiley at 05:44 AM on February 03, 2008

    The annual Icycle fest occured this weekend in Fontana Village, NC.  A steelar event put on by J&W events and Sycamore Cycles
     Typically the weather has been quite rough in years past, cold rain and or snow.  But not this time beautiful sunny weather, which should have mean't great riding...
    This was to be my first XC race of the season, and first time on a MTB in months.  I have been trapped on the trainer due to the snow covered roads and waist deep snow on the trails of my home.  Anyway...  I felt good at the start and was rearing to rip.  I soon realized the condition my body was in though.  Half way through the second lap my physical and mental condition rapidly declined, a couple of major crashes and a little vommiting (yeaaaa).  On my third lap I was passed by numerous riders in my class (I stopped counting after around 10).  The technical skills were on mostly but that does not cut it at all.
   Enough about me though.  The event was one of the most professionally handled ones I have ever attended.  The XC race went great.  Than it was time for folks to start getting ready for the Night downhill race.  I headed down to the finish and hooked up some rider's with my kick ass demo bikes.  We also did some pretty major repairs at the finish also.  We cobbed a Hayes brake hose back together using some Avid parts and a papper clip (some of my greatest work).  I also met tons of genuinely great people.  Unfortunatly I had to leave at night fall to make my next destination, so I missed the actual DH race.
    Many thanks to Wes, Jay, and Chris for their awesome dedication to sport and putting on an incredible event.
